Pancreatic cancer
Using MRI as a primary image set to define a pancreatic adenocarcinoma GTV resulted in smaller contours compared with CT. No differences in DSC or the conformity index were seen between MRI and CT. A stepwise method is recommended as an approach to contour a pancreatic GTV using MRI.
With this report, we attempt to provide recommendations for MRI-based contouring of pancreatic tumors and OARs. Hepatocellular cancer
In a group of experts, excellent agreement was seen in contouring total GTV. Heterogeneity exists in the definition of portal vein thrombus that may impact treatment planning, especially if differential dosing is contemplated. Guidelines for HCC GTV contouring are recommended.

Consensus contouring guidelines for postoperative completely resected cavity SRS treatment were established using expert contours and clinical practice. However, in the absence of clinical data supporting these recommendations, these guidelines serve as a baseline for further study and refinement.

A single (marginal) dose of 20 Gy is a reasonable choice that balances the effect on the treated lesion (local control, partial remission) against the risk of late side effects (radionecrosis). Higher doses (22-25 Gy) may be used for smaller (< 1 cm) lesions, while a dose reduction to 18 Gy may b &
